Depersonalization meaning
- The act of depersonalizing or the state of being depersonalized.
- The loss of one's sense of personal identity.
- A feeling of being unreal, detached or unable to feel emotion.

Example sentences (2)
He concluded that a serious crisis occurred in European civilization in 1900 because of the rise of anti-Semitism, extreme nationalism, discontent with the parliamentary system, depersonalization of the state, and the rejection of positivism.
In addition to the sensory-perceptual effects, hallucinogenic substances may induce feelings of depersonalization, emotional shifts to a euphoric or anxious/fearful state, and a disruption of logical thought.
